About The Role
Abnormal Security is looking for a Backend Engineer to join the Dev Accelerator team.
The rise of AI tools offers unprecedented opportunities to amplify our engineering capabilities, but capitalizing on these tools requires intentional strategy, deep integration, and thoughtful enablement. This is where our team excels—driving systemic improvements, fostering collaboration, and ensuring that every engineer can focus on solving impactful problems.
Our responsibilities include:
- Evolving Dev Infrastructure: Continuously refining our development environment to adapt for emerging technologies, especially Generative AI tools.
- Cutting-Edge Testing Framework: Ensuring that teams can deliver high-quality, reliable software at speed.
- Define the right way to build: Providing well-defined templates for various service types to simplify and accelerate development.
With a team of 250 engineers and AI revolution, this need has never been more critical.
Must Have:
- 3+ years working on relevant tech stacks - Python (Django) and Go, MySQL & PostgreSQL databases, ElasticSearch, Redis, and Kafka
- 2+ years of production support experience for enterprise-class customers
- At least 1+ years of system design experience

What We Do
The Abnormal Security platform protects enterprises from targeted email attacks. Abnormal Behavior Technology (ABX) models the identity of both employees and external senders, profiles relationships and analyzes email content to stop attacks that lead to account takeover, financial damage and organizational mistrust. Though one-click, API-based Office 365 and G Suite integration, Abnormal sets up in minutes and does not disrupt email flow.
Abnormal Security was founded in 2018 by CEO Evan Reiser, CTO Sanjay Jeyakumar, Head of Machine Learning Jeshua Bratman, and Founding Engineers Abhijit Bagri and Dmitry Chechik. The team previously built behavioral profiling and machine learning technologies at Twitter, Google and Pinterest that are being applied to solve a problem that costs organizations $1 billion per year, according to the FBI. The Abnormal Security platform stops targeted phishing, business email compromise and account takeover attacks that have never been seen before.
